I got myself a "Boesman" this weekend, it has just over 30k km on the clock and rides beautifully :ricky:
Apparently this model is not a "farm version"of the XR / XL / CR 200 Honda's, so lets start sharing some tech detail in a separate thread.
I have consulted Google and other than some aussie gumtree ads, didn't find much:
A decent Review (South African)
Same Boertjie, different article
The Honda Basic Specification Sheet
According to the Honda.za site they currently sell for R31 999 :eek7:
Got 175km before I had to switch over to reserve, GPS indicated just over 100k/h on the flat, but I was doing 80km/h sustain-ably on the highway, KTM 990 couldn't keep up with me in the sand, KLR couldn't keep up in the bush ot:
Does anyone know of a extended fuel tank that fits without too many modifications?
Anyone changed sprocket ratio's? The first gear is almost too low, you need to start focusing on your balance or change to second.
